Fix back compat of catalog java api
The switch to osgi bundles and `TypeRegistry` caused confusion where people were consuming the `BrooklynCatalog` API and expecting (reasonably) to see the things they've added. This PR makes those methods also look in the `TypeRegistry` with `...Legacy(...)` methods added to explicitly search only in the catalog.
All methods are deprecated so in 1.0 we can hopefully delete!
